Biltmore Estate's Secret Passages – Asheville, North Carolina - Atlas Obscura The estate also boasts one underground tunnel in Antler Hill Village (located three miles from the house) that used to be part of the Biltmore Dairy Barn. The stone tunnel leads to a winery.
